From a1ae9d712f1d18799c3e4e34995fd037f6c5a22a Mon Sep 17 00:00:00 2001 From: xiaoyong931011 <15274802129@163.com> Date: Wed, 19 Jul 2023 16:56:32 +0800 Subject: [PATCH] 商城商品修改 --- src/main/java/cc/mrbird/febs/mall/controller/ApiMallAddressInfoController.java | 9 +++++++++ 1 files changed, 9 insertions(+), 0 deletions(-) diff --git a/src/main/java/cc/mrbird/febs/mall/controller/ApiMallAddressInfoController.java b/src/main/java/cc/mrbird/febs/mall/controller/ApiMallAddressInfoController.java index 6130cf7..3fe8124 100644 --- a/src/main/java/cc/mrbird/febs/mall/controller/ApiMallAddressInfoController.java +++ b/src/main/java/cc/mrbird/febs/mall/controller/ApiMallAddressInfoController.java @@ -3,6 +3,7 @@ import cc.mrbird.febs.common.entity.FebsResponse; import cc.mrbird.febs.mall.conversion.MallAddressInfoConversion; import cc.mrbird.febs.mall.dto.AddressInfoDto; +import cc.mrbird.febs.mall.dto.ApiIdentifyAddressDto; import cc.mrbird.febs.mall.entity.MallAddressInfo; import cc.mrbird.febs.mall.service.IApiMallAddressInfoService; import cc.mrbird.febs.mall.vo.AddressInfoVo; @@ -15,6 +16,7 @@ import org.springframework.validation.annotation.Validated; import org.springframework.web.bind.annotation.*; +import javax.validation.Valid; import java.util.List; /** @@ -24,6 +26,7 @@ @Slf4j @Validated @RestController +@CrossOrigin("*") @RequiredArgsConstructor @RequestMapping(value = "/api/address") @Api(value = "ApiMallAddressInfoController", tags = "用户地址管理接口类") @@ -77,4 +80,10 @@ return new FebsResponse().success().message("设置成功"); } + @ApiOperation(value = "智能识别地址", notes = "智能识别地址") + @PostMapping(value = "/identifyAddress") + public FebsResponse identifyAddress(@RequestBody @Valid ApiIdentifyAddressDto identifyAddressDto) { + return mallAddressInfoService.identifyAddress(identifyAddressDto); + } + } -- Gitblit v1.9.1